BlueprintAssignable
只包含组播委托。属性应暴露在分配蓝图中。
BlueprintCallable
只包含组播委托。属性应暴露在调用代码蓝图中。
BlueprintReadOnly
此属性可以在蓝图中都读取,但不能修改。
BlueprintReadWrite
此属性允许在蓝图中被读或写。
Category
指定该属性类别。用法:Category=类别名
Config
此变量将进行配置。当前值可保存到ini文件,并且将在创建时被加载。
在默认属性中不能赋值意味着它是只读的。
DuplicateTransient
指示变量的值应该在任何类型的复制(复制/粘贴,复制的二进制等)时被重置为默认类值。
EditAnywhere
表明这个属性可以通过编辑器中的属性窗口进行编辑。
EditDefaultsOnly
表明这个属性可以通过编辑器中的属性窗口进行编辑,但仅限于原型。
EditFixedSize
唯一有用的动态数组。这将防止用户从经由虚幻编辑属性窗口改变的阵列的长度。
EditInline
允许用户编辑由虚幻编辑器的属性检查器中的这个变量所引用的对象的属性
(仅适用于对象引用,包括数组对象引用)。
Instanced
仅限于对象属性。当创建该类的一个实例时,它将被给予对象的唯一拷贝到默认变量中。
用于实例化用于实例化类的默认属性定义的子对象。意味着EditInline 和Export。
Transient
瞬时属性:不会被保存,加载时零填充。
AdvancedDisplay
属性在详细信息面板的高级下拉列表中
AssetRegistrySearchable
AssetRegistrySearchable关键字表示该属性及其值将被自动添加 到资产注册表的任何资产类实例包含这个成员变量。 这是不合法的struct属性或参数。
duplicatetransient
在任何类型的复制(复制/粘贴,二进制复制等)期间,属性都应该被重置为默认值。